No G-Tech does not tell the exact truth, i have a G-Tech unit but i test it only to see the power incrase, do a test, do a mod, and again do a test, and this way i see how many ~HP i gained due to that mod.

if u know someone who have same g-tech like u try to use both devices when u do a run and u will notice diferent result (not big diference but it is, on same car same run 2 identical devices shows diferent resul...)

and about testing on 2 diferent cars there is no relation betwen the power figures

my car 200SX CA18DET 169HP when was stock the gtech showed ~154HP
my friend car Vento VR6 2.8L 174HP, the gtech showed 121-123 HP

400m race betwen us i was with about 3-4 meters in fron of him at the finish (the weight of the cars is almost the same ~20Kg diference, so in my belife it is no way that if that 30HP diference was true betwen us ,at the finish line be only 3-4 meter diference)

anyway i belife the G-Tech is good only to see the ~HP gain afther a mod, the time is irelevant.

when it showed ~154HP my best time was 7.17
when it showed ~174HP my best time was 6.69
when it showed ~204HP my best time was 6.6
i refer to 0-60 time
400m time never tested that

converting whp to bhp using Pumaracing's formulaThis one?
http://www.pumaracing.co.uk/trans.htm
That's nearly just as much rubbish as the dyno results he's complaing about in coastdown losses.
http://www.pumaracing.co.uk/coastdwn.htm

Applying his +10bhp and / 0.9 rule for FWD to the wheel power for the XR2 he tested.
3rd gear - 95 bhp at the wheels
4th gear - 92 bhp at the wheels
5th gear - 88 bhp at the wheels
Gives
3rd 116.7bhp, 4th 113.3bhp and 5th 108.9bhp. He has lost/gained 9bhp between 3rd and top and only top gear gives a good approximation to expected power. Anyone applying this to a test in 4th will get the wrong result. Anyone with a different top gear/diff ratio/wheel size to the XR2 will also get a wrong result.

Above 30mph RWD and FWD trans efficiency is proportional to speed
My best fit using the XR2's data is Engine power = wheel power / (0.971 - (0.00125 x mph)).
XR2 speed in gears at max power is 75, 101, 127mph.
Engine power using above is 3rd 108.4 bhp, 4th 109bhp, 5th 108.4bhp.
A variation of 0.6bhp and somewhat closer to the expected 108.5bhp than his forumla. I can get an exact fit using a formula with speed squared term but dyno results are not accurate enough to make it worthwhile.

Below 30mph the losses are not proportional to speed but won't drop below a limiting value set by gear meshing efficiency - 99% per spur gear. 98.5% for a helical diff. This only applies above 30mph as the biggest loss is due to the diff crown wheel flinging oil and it has a different oil fling mode at low speed - more like a paddle wheel and the level stays full. It may also go to pot above 150mph or whatever speeds it is when the oil level in gearbox and diff reach a lowest possible level and the oil is being flung at the case walls faster than it can drain back so there is no more reduction in wetted area of the gear.

4wd will be a bit more due to 2 diffs flinging oil (though they tend to be smaller) and a power splitter. I haven't done much analysis yet but losses are something like (0.96 - (0.0015 x mph)). The 2nd diff doesn't give a 2nd meshing loss as the loss is 2 * 1/2 power x effy = same as single diff. The only addititional meashing loss is in the transfer gear or chain.
